Output 50b58f629acff04baae266414e31e712ab1ae9bf27ff5948238fa4f89bf56990:31

value
679668
script pubkey
OP_0 OP_PUSHBYTES_20 a4c57aa4eabd148aa247263ea35cfb3ce7f95570
address
bc1q5nzh4f82h52g4gj8ycl2xh8m8nnlj4tsvesge9
transaction
50b58f629acff04baae266414e31e712ab1ae9bf27ff5948238fa4f89bf56990